Bits to Kibibits Converter

Result:

0 Kibibits

Mastering UI Design with CSS Button Generators: A Comprehensive Guide

In today's digital landscape, user interface (UI) design plays a pivotal role in the success of any website or application. An intuitive and visually appealing interface not only enhances user experience but also helps in conveying the brand message effectively. Among the essential elements of UI design, buttons serve as key interactive components that facilitate user actions such as navigation, submission, and interaction. Crafting buttons that are both visually appealing and functionally efficient is crucial for achieving a seamless user experience. In this comprehensive guide, we delve into the realm of UI design with a focus on mastering button design using CSS button generators.

Understanding CSS Button Generators:

CSS (Cascading Style Sheets) button generators are powerful tools that simplify the process of creating visually striking buttons with minimal effort. These tools utilize CSS code to generate buttons with various styles, shapes, and effects, allowing designers to customize them according to specific project requirements. By eliminating the need for manual coding, CSS button generators enable designers to focus more on creativity and experimentation, resulting in the creation of unique and engaging button designs.

Benefits of Using CSS Button Generators:

Time Efficiency: Traditional button design involves writing complex CSS code from scratch, which can be time-consuming and tedious. CSS button generators automate this process, significantly reducing design time and effort.

Consistency: Maintaining consistency in button styles across an entire website or application is essential for a cohesive user experience. CSS button generators offer pre-defined templates and customization options, ensuring consistency in design elements throughout the interface.

Flexibility: CSS button generators provide a wide range of customization options, including color schemes, border styles, hover effects, and more. Designers can easily tailor buttons to align with brand aesthetics and user preferences, thereby enhancing visual appeal and usability.

Responsive Design: With the increasing prevalence of mobile devices, responsive design has become imperative for modern UI/UX design. CSS button generators offer responsive design capabilities, allowing buttons to adapt seamlessly to different screen sizes and resolutions.

Key Features of CSS Button Generators:

  • Template Selection: CSS button generators offer a variety of templates ranging from simple flat buttons to complex gradient-filled buttons. Designers can choose a template that best suits the design theme and project requirements.
  • Customization Options: From adjusting button size and shape to fine-tuning hover effects and typography, CSS button generators provide an array of customization options to cater to diverse design preferences.
  • Live Preview: Many CSS button generators offer a live preview feature, allowing designers to visualize changes in real-time as they customize button styles. This interactive approach streamlines the design process and enables quick iteration.
  • Code Export: Once the desired button design is achieved, CSS button generators facilitate easy code export, providing designers with clean and optimized CSS code that can be seamlessly integrated into web projects.

Best Practices for Using CSS Button Generators:

Keep it Simple: While CSS button generators offer a plethora of customization options, it's essential to maintain simplicity in design. Avoid cluttering buttons with excessive effects or unnecessary elements that may distract users.

Consistency is Key: Establish a consistent button style across all pages of the website or application to create a unified user experience. Stick to a cohesive color palette, typography, and button shapes to reinforce brand identity.

Optimize for Performance: Optimize CSS code generated by button generators to ensure fast loading times and optimal performance. Minimize unnecessary code and utilize CSS preprocessors like Sass or Less for efficient styling.

Test Across Devices: Before deploying buttons generated using CSS button generators, thoroughly test their functionality and appearance across various devices and browsers to ensure compatibility and responsiveness.

Conclusion:

Mastering UI design with CSS button generators empowers designers to create visually stunning buttons that enhance user experience and elevate the overall appeal of websites and applications. By leveraging the efficiency and versatility of CSS button generators, designers can streamline the button design process, maintain consistency, and deliver intuitive interfaces that captivate users. With continuous experimentation and adherence to best practices, designers can unlock endless possibilities in UI design and create compelling digital experiences that resonate with audiences worldwide.